- The distance between Sunnyside, Wa, Usa and Franca, Brazil is approximately 10,375 km or 6,447 mi.
- To reach Sunnyside, Wa in this distance one would set out from Franca bearing 318.4° or NW and follow the great circles arc to approach Sunnyside, Wa bearing 296.5° or WNW .
- Sunnyside, Wa has a mid-latitude cool desert climate (BWk) whereas Franca has a subtropical highland climate with dry winters (Cwb).
- Sunnyside, Wa is in or near the cool temperate desert scrub biome whereas Franca is in or near the subtropical moist forest biome.
- The mean annual temperature is 6.6 °C (11.9°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 17.8 °C (32°F) more in Sunnyside, Wa. The continentality subtype is subcontinental as opposed to truly hyperoce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 1453.5 mm (57.2 in) less which is equivalent to 1453.5 l/m² (35.67 US gal/ft²) or 14,535,000 l/ha (1,553,888 US gal/ac) less. About 1/9 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 23.8° lower in Sunnyside, Wa than in Franca.
